The Constitution may bar a criminal defendant from being compelled to testify against himself, but in the Lawrence Horn murder trial, prosecutors may have found the next best thing.

For most of an hour today, the jury watched Horn on videotape as he gave sworn answers to key questions about the slayings of nurse Janice Roberts Saunders and his former wife, Mildred Horn, and their 8-year-old son, Trevor.

Jurors saw Horn pause after being asked whether he knew what would happen to Trevor's $1.7 million estate were the severely retarded boy to die. They watched Horn begin to smile as ...
